首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

查询域名解析是否生效

要查询域名解析是否生效,可以通过以下几种方法:

一、使用命令行工具(以Windows系统下的nslookup为例)

  1. 基础概念
    • 域名解析是将域名转换为对应的IP地址的过程。DNS(Domain Name System)服务器负责这个转换工作。
  • 查询步骤
    • 打开命令提示符(在Windows系统中可以通过搜索“cmd”打开)。
    • 输入命令“nslookup [域名]”,例如“nslookup example.com”。
    • 如果解析成功,会显示该域名对应的IP地址以及相关的DNS服务器信息。如果解析失败,可能会显示类似“找不到主机”的提示。
  • 优势
    • 简单直接,不需要额外的软件安装(在大多数操作系统中自带nslookup工具)。
    • 可以快速获取域名的基本解析信息。
  • 应用场景
    • 网络故障排查时确定域名是否能正确解析到预期的IP地址。
    • 在配置服务器或网站访问时验证域名解析的正确性。

二、使用在线工具

  1. 基础概念
    • 在线域名解析查询工具是基于DNS查询原理构建的网络服务。它们通过自己的DNS服务器或者调用公共DNS服务器来查询域名解析情况。
  • 查询步骤
    • 打开一个在线域名解析查询网站,如“https://www.whatsmydns.net/”。
    • 在输入框中输入要查询的域名,然后点击查询按钮。
    • 网站会显示该域名在全球不同地区的解析状态,包括是否解析成功以及对应的IP地址等信息。
  • 优势
    • 方便快捷,不需要在本地执行命令操作。
    • 可以提供全球范围内的解析情况概览,有助于判断域名解析是否在全球正常生效。
  • 应用场景
    • 对于全球用户分布的应用或网站,检查域名解析在全球的可用性。
    • 快速验证域名解析状态而不需要熟悉命令行操作。

三、可能遇到的问题及解决方法

  1. 解析失败
    • 原因:
      • 域名注册信息错误,例如域名没有正确指向DNS服务器。
      • DNS服务器故障,可能是注册商的DNS服务器出现问题或者是自己配置的私有DNS服务器故障。
      • 域名刚刚注册或修改解析记录,由于DNS缓存的存在,可能还未生效(DNS缓存时间通常为几分钟到数小时不等)。
    • 解决方法:
      • 检查域名注册商处的域名设置,确保正确配置了DNS服务器地址。
      • 如果使用自己的DNS服务器,检查服务器的状态和配置。
      • 等待一段时间(通常最多24小时)让DNS缓存过期重新解析,或者可以通过修改本地计算机的hosts文件(在Windows系统中位于“C:\Windows\System32\drivers\etc\hosts”,在Linux和macOS系统中位于“/etc/hosts”)来临时指定域名对应的IP地址进行测试。
  • 解析到错误的IP地址
    • 原因:
      • 在域名注册商处错误地配置了解析记录,例如A记录或CNAME记录指向了错误的IP地址或别名。
      • 存在恶意篡改DNS记录的情况(虽然这种情况相对较少且通常伴随着网络安全漏洞)。
    • 解决方法:
      • 仔细检查域名注册商处的DNS解析记录设置,确保正确无误。
      • 如果怀疑被恶意篡改,联系域名注册商进行调查和处理,同时检查网站的安全防护措施是否存在漏洞。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

查询DNS的记录 查看域名解析是否正常

nslookup命令用于查询DNS的记录,查看域名解析是否正常,在网络故障的时候用来诊断网络问题。...直接查询 查询一个域名的A记录 nslookup domain [dns-server] nslookup www.google.com 8.8.8.8 Server: 8.8.8.8 Address...: 8.8.8.8#53 Non-authoritative answer: Name: www.google.com Address: 172.217.5.196 查询其他记录 指定参数,查询其他记录...改名的邮箱记录 MX 邮件服务器记录 NS 名字服务器记录 PTR 反向记录 RP 负责人记录 RT 路由穿透记录 SRV TCP服务器信息记录 TXT 域名对应的文本信息 X25 域名对应的X.25地址记录 查询更具体的信息...nslookup –d [其他参数] domain [dns-server] 只要在查询的时候,加上-d参数,即可查询域名的缓存。

15.4K20
  • 怎么看域名解析是否生效?

    怎么看域名解析是否生效?下面小编就为大家来详细介绍一下相关的知识。 image.png 怎么看域名的ip地址? 每个网站都会有各自的域名,域名也会对应一个IPD地址,那么怎么看域名的ip地址呢?...一般来说想要查询IPD地址的话需要使用到计算机的命令提示符号,打开电脑-运行,然后输入cmd点击回车,在弹出的页面输入ping+你想要查看的域名,然后点击回车就可以看到网站域名的IP地址了。...怎么看域名解析是否生效? 大家都知道网站的域名是需要解析之后才可以正式使用的,那么怎么看域名解析是否生效呢?...这里我们也需要用到计算机的命令提示符号,在输入ping -t 你的域名之后,看看返回的IP地址是否和设置的A指向IP地址是否相同,相同就代表域名解析生效了,反之就是没有生效。

    17.1K30

    hncloud:如何检查内核参数是否生效

    检查内核参数是否生效,可以通过以下几种方法:方法一:使用 cat 命令查看当前启动的内核参数在终端中输入以下命令:cat /proc/cmdline这个命令会显示当前启动时传递给内核的所有参数。...你可以在这里查找你关心的参数,看它们的值是否符合你的设置。...这个命令会搜索GRUB配置文件,查看你的参数是否已经被正确添加到启动条目中。...你可以在这里查看特定进程是否使用了你设置的内核参数。注意事项在使用这些命令时,你可能需要具有相应的权限,某些命令可能需要 sudo。确保在修改内核参数后重启系统,以便更改生效。...通过以上方法,你可以验证你设置的内核参数是否已经生效。如果参数没有生效,你可能需要重新检查你的GRUB配置文件,确保参数被正确添加,并且没有语法错误。

    12710

    腾讯云如何判断CDN是否生效

    您好,您可参考以下两种方式判断CDN是否生效: 方式一:通过控制台判断 1. 登录CDN控制台,进入 域名管理 列表页面。 2....如果域名的CNAME解析已有正确解析提示,表示当前CDN域名加速已生效。如果有两条CNAME解析的情况下,其中一条生效即可。...方式二:通过命令判断 您也可以使用nslookup或dig命令来查看当前域名的解析生效状态。 1. 如果您的系统为Windows系统,在Window系统中打开CMD运行程序。...您可以在CMD内运行:nslookup -qt=cname www.test.com,根据运行的解析结果内,可以查看该域名的CNAME信息,如果与腾讯云CDN提供的CNAME地址一致,即当前CDN加速已生效...www.test.com为例,您可以在终端内运行命令:dig www.test.com,根据运行的解析结果内,可以查看该域名的CNAME信息,如果与腾讯云CDN提供的CNAME地址一致,即当前的CDN加速已生效

    2.3K40

    一般如何将域名解析到ip?域名解析后需要多久才能生效?

    在购买了域名之后,首先要做的就是域名解析,在进行域名解析后,才能够有效建立域名和ip之间的稳定联系,对于没有经验的使用者来说,一般如何将域名解析到ip呢?在进行域名解析后多久才能生效呢?...一般如何将域名解析到ip 1、想要进行域名解析,首先要知道ip地址,在了解ip地址后,再设置解析记录和解析类型即可。如果不知道ip地址的话,也可以直接咨询服务器的运营商。 2、进行地址管理。...3、进入域名解析的高级页面,并按照系统要求填写域名的相关信息,添加解析类型为A类型,随后保存相关设置。最后只需要耐心等待域名解析生效即可。...域名解析后需要多久才能生效 域名进行解析之后并不会立马生效,需要一定的解析时间才能生效,一般来说生效时间为24小时。由于各地区的服务器运营时间和工作效率不同,各地的生效时间都在6-24小时以内。...在进行域名解析后,可以耐心等待一段时间,并使用ping域名进行检测域名是否已经生效。如果域名超过24小时还未生效的话,可以上网求助或检测原因。

    14K21

    查询域名是否被K

    这次留了个心眼,想查一下中意的域名是否被百度K过,不然收录是个问题。...查询网站曾经是否被注册过 1、 http://whois.domaintools.com 这个网站提供查询功能,而且功能还很强大,可以看到,我的这个域名之前是被人注册过的。...2、通过(site:域名),看下是否有记录,然后查看下反向链接,利用(link:域名)或者(domain:域名)。...也可以到一些提供查询反向连接的网站去查询或者自己到搜索引擎利用命令查询,如果有反向连接,而site却没有结果,那么这个域名很有可能被k了。...3、打开http://web.archive.org/web/ 输入自己想要查询的域名然后按Take Me Back,如果做过网站都会有数据显示出来。

    12.1K10

    【计算机网络】应用层 : DNS 域名解析系统 ( 域名 | 域名服务器 | 域名解析过程 | 递归查询 | 迭代查询 | 高速缓存 )

    文章目录 一、域名 二、域名服务器 三、域名解析过程 四、递归查询 五、迭代查询 六、高速缓存 一、域名 ---- 域名 : ① 域名表示方法 : 字母 , 数字 , “-” 符号 , “.”...; 三、域名解析过程 ---- 域名解析过程 : 递归查询 迭代查询 四、递归查询 ---- 递归查询 : 委托给别人查找 ; 委托查找 : 先在 本地域名服务器 中查找 , 如果没有 , 委托 根域名服务器...: 找到域名对应的 IP 地址后 , 按照委托顺序 , 权限域名服务器 -> 顶级域名服务器 -> 根域名服务器 -> 本地域名服务器 -> 主机 , 返回查找的域名对应的 IP 地址 ; 五、迭代查询...---- 迭代查询 : 靠自己查找 ; 核心是 本地域名服务器 ; 主机 向 本地域名服务器 查询 域名 ; 本地域名服务器 没有查找到 , 向 根域名服务器 查找 , 跟域名服务器没有找到 , 将..., 如果找到域名对应地址 , 将结果传回 ; 本地域名服务器 将最终查询结果 传给 主机 ; 六、高速缓存 高速缓存 : 在 主机 , 本地域名服务器 , 根域名服务器 , 顶级域名服务器 , 权限域名服务器

    4.8K01
    领券